What is the Application for Group Coverage?
The Application for Group Coverage is a crucial form for businesses seeking health insurance through Independence Blue Cross. This form initiates the group coverage application process, enabling employers to secure health coverage for their employees efficiently. It features several necessary components, including both the applicant's and the Group Administrator's signing requirements, ensuring all information is validated and verified prior to submission.
Using this health insurance application is vital as it streamlines the process of accessing essential medical coverage, providing businesses with a structured approach to meeting their employees' healthcare needs.

Who is eligible to fill out the Application for Group Coverage?
Eligibility for this form typically includes employers or organizations looking to acquire group health insurance for their employees, as well as staff members designated as Group Administrators overseeing health benefits.
What information do I need to gather before completing the form?
Before starting the application, collect personal details of the primary applicant, information about dependents, Social Security numbers, and preferred health plan options to ensure a smooth and efficient filling process.
How can I submit the completed Application for Group Coverage?
You can submit the completed application via various methods, including direct mail, email, or fax. Ensure you follow the submission guidelines included on the form for accurate processing.
Are there any common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include leaving sections blank, misentering Social Security numbers, and failing to obtain required signatures from both the applicant and Group Administrator. Be diligent in reviewing the form before submission.
What is the processing time for the application once submitted?
Processing times for the Application for Group Coverage can vary, but expect a turnaround of a few weeks. Check with Independence Blue Cross for specific timeframes regarding your application.
Does this form require notarization?
No, the Application for Group Coverage does not require notarization. However, both the applicant and Group Administrator must sign the form to validate it.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Application for Group Coverage?
While specific deadlines can vary based on insurance plans, it is best to submit the application as soon as possible to ensure you meet any enrollment periods set by Independence Blue Cross.
